  • Bio

    "You'll have to do a double take after your first glimpse of this pop/folk duo from Tucson, AZ. Twin sisters make-up the band "Mirror Image" that took the Battle of the Bands in Tucson by storm. With their self-proclaimed injection of "Girl Power" into the battle they surprised only themselves when they came out victorious. Your eyes might have trouble keeping up, but your ears will find themselves at home sweet home with this double dose of soulful vocals and swinging guitar." (John Lennon Educational Tour Bus, 2008) Andrea and Juliet Wilhelmi grew up in Roundup, Montana. Music has always been part of their lives. Piano was their first instrument, but after receiving guitars for Christmas at age 12, they never looked back. Writing songs seemed like the "natural thing to do". They began performing in local venues and they recorded their first demos in the basement of a friend and Nashville performer, Mike Morgan. In 2008 Mirror Image was be chosen as the winner of the Arizona Star Tucson Battle of the Bands. Part of their prize, was a day on the John Lennon Educational Tour Bus making a music video of their original song, "Miserable Thing." When the bus came to Tucson in 2009, Mirror Image shot a music video to their song, "Romeo". Their song "Dearest Stranger" was chosen as a finalist in the 2009 "Show Me the Music" songwriting contest. Their song, "The Red Knight" is a 2009 semi-finalist in the 100% Music Songwriting Contest, Anders, France. In March, 2011, their song "Smile for You" was a finalist in the Great American Song Contest and a semi-finalist in the Song of the Year contest. Their first CD, "Technicolor" is now available. In addition to originals, the duo's repertoire includes covers of The Beatles, Leonard Cohen, Norah Jones, Dean Martin, Neil Young, Elvis Presley, and others. Andrea and Juliet have been familiar faces around the Tucson music scene... Tucson Folk Festival, Downtown Saturday Night, First Night. Andrea and Juliet are now students at Macalester College. In addition to their studies they have begun exploring the St. Paul/ Minneapolis music scene.
